Hey Scott. I actually did most of my trout fishing in Claysburg, which is about 30 minutes south of Altoona, back when i was in Ohio. I was born and partially raised near Altoona. I have fished Raystown many times when I go back to trout fish and also when I was younger. The stripers are going to be deep by that time but that lake has some serious deep water. If you want to know some history on the place it use to be an old town and they flooded the town in preparations for the war or something to that matter. So there is houses down there so they make great structures and you will find stripers hanging around the rubble. The best bait i ever used was trout about 5-7 inches and the stripers love them. They are available at the local bait shops but are expensive.
